Boomsa Beerenberg Distillery
Edisonstraat 4-6, 8912 AW, Leeuwarden - Netherlands

Map
The Boomsma museum and visitor centre is located in the centre of Leeuwarden. The museum explains how a distillery works, and takes visitors back to the 1930s to reveal the traditional process used by the Boomsma family to make the herb-flavoured gin that is a regional speciality. The museum displays a number of items used in the distilling process, including vessels, fill machines and a ‘nosing turntable’. There is also a tasting room where you can sample some of the gin yourself.
